About
This skill establishes a foundational test strategy based on Behavior-Driven Development (BDD) and a three-tiered 'Confidence Pyramid.' It guides Claude to prioritize real-world reliability over arbitrary coverage metrics by enforcing a strict 'no-mocking' policy. By advocating for dependency injection at the unit level and rigorous test harnesses at the integration level, this skill ensures that software actually works in production. It also introduces a disciplined workflow separating 'progress tests' (in-development) from 'regression tests' (production-ready), providing a structured roadmap for building resilient, well-architected systems.